With all the revived hype surrounding Billy from the latest S4 trailer, I’m reminded why I will forever be grateful that the role was given to someone like Dacre Montgomery. With all the speculation of Billy not only returning, but possibly returning as ANOTHER corrupted version of himself, Dacre is the only reason why I still have hope for Billy’s arc.
He is the reason why Billy is as complex and nuanced as he is in canon. Judging from past interviews, it seems like the Duffers were content to just let Billy be this two dimensional bully who’s an irredeemable maniac (and possibly still believe he is to some extent). But it was Dacre who humanized him. He understood that no one is simply born evil, that people like Billy have deeper issues going on in their lives. He suggested to add the scene with his dad abusing him and to give him a backstory of how he was abandoned by the only person who loved him. He demonstrated how all that shit twisted a sweet little boy into an angry, aggressive teenager. It would be enough to turn anybody into a Billy Hargrove.
Dacre gave the audience a reason to sympathize with Billy and demonstrated how he still has the potential to become a better person and overcome his toxic ways.
So, no matter what role Billy plays this season (whether it be alive, in flashbacks, or in some monster form), I trust that Dacre will put all his effort to maintain and continue Billy’s character development.

I feel so gross whenever fanon plays off Snape's parental issues as an excuse that he actively uses, in-universe, to make Lily feel sorry for him and overlook his bad behavior.
Not only is it out-of character for him, the way it's often portrayed gives off the impression that Snape's account of the severity of the situation is unreliable — when the only context his abusive home life is ever brought up is when he's being emotionally manipulative for personal gain, isn't it then likely that he would be exaggerating the situation?
A really prominent trait of canon Snape is that he doesn't like being pitied. He actually hates being seen as a victim. He would much rather be seen as a terrible person than as a hurt, vulnerable one. It's the reason he ends up calling Lily mudblood in the first place. It's why he'd sooner join the Death Eaters than reach out for help.
IDK — Just the fact that some antis apparently acknowledge Snape's canonically abusive childhood, but then spin it into something he consistently takes advantage of to manipulate others for sympathy and forgiveness to the point it comes off as deceptive, when that's actually pretty much the opposite of how he acts in canon... it makes my skin crawl.
